<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>60224</bug_id>
          
          <creation_ts>2011-05-04 16:01:23 -0700</creation_ts>
          <short_desc>[Qt] RenderThemeQt and DumpRenderTreeSupportQt should use nullptr rather than 0.</short_desc>
          <delta_ts>2011-05-05 07:14:34 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>New Bugs</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>Unspecified</rep_platform>
          <op_sys>Unspecified</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ords>Qt, QtTriaged</ke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Alexis Menard (darktears)">menard</reporter>
          <assigned_to name="Alexis Menard (darktears)">menard</assigned_to>
          
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>398350</commentid>
    <comment_count>0</comment_count>
    <who name="Alexis Menard (darktears)">menard</who>
    <bug_when>2011-05-04 16:01:23 -0700</bug_when>
    <thetext>[Qt] RenderThemeQt and DumpRenderTreeSupportQt should use nullptr rather than 0.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>398354</commentid>
    <comment_count>1</comment_count>
      <attachid>92339</attachid>
    <who name="Alexis Menard (darktears)">menard</who>
    <bug_when>2011-05-04 16:05:52 -0700</bug_when>
    <thetext>Created attachment 92339
Patch</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>398358</commentid>
    <comment_count>2</comment_count>
    <who name="Alexis Menard (darktears)">menard</who>
    <bug_when>2011-05-04 16:06:34 -0700</bug_when>
    <thetext>See RenderTheme.cpp to double check what I&apos;m saying.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>398694</commentid>
    <comment_count>3</comment_count>
      <attachid>92339</attachid>
    <who name="Andreas Kling">kling</who>
    <bug_when>2011-05-05 06:43:48 -0700</bug_when>
    <thetext>Comment on attachment 92339
Patch

View in context: https://bugs.webkit.org/attachment.cgi?id=92339&amp;action=review

Did you performance test this?

&gt; Source/WebCore/ChangeLog:9
&gt; +        but webkit already have a nullptr class if there is no c++0x support.

webkit -&gt; WebKit
have -&gt; has

&gt; Source/WebKit/qt/ChangeLog:9
&gt; +        We should use nullptr rather than 0. nullptr will be added in the new C++ standard
&gt; +        but webkit already have a nullptr class if there is no c++0x support.

Ditto.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>398706</commentid>
    <comment_count>4</comment_count>
    <who name="Alexis Menard (darktears)">menard</who>
    <bug_when>2011-05-05 07:14:34 -0700</bug_when>
    <thetext>Committed r85851: &lt;http://trac.webkit.org/changeset/85851&gt;</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>92339</attachid>
            <date>2011-05-04 16:05:52 -0700</date>
            <delta_ts>2011-05-05 06:43:47 -0700</delta_ts>
            <desc>Patch</desc>
            <filename>bug-60224-20110504200558.patch</filename>
            <type>text/plain</type>
            <size>3810</size>
            <attacher name="Alexis Menard (darktears)">menard</attacher>
            
              <data encoding="base64">SW5kZXg6IFNvdXJjZS9XZWJDb3JlL0NoYW5nZUxvZwo9P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09Ci0tLSBTb3VyY2UvV2Vi
Q29yZS9DaGFuZ2VMb2cJKHJldmlzaW9uIDg1ODAwKQorKysgU291cmNlL1dlYkNvcmUvQ2hhbmdl
TG9nCSh3b3JraW5nIGNvcHkpCkBAIC0xLDMgKzEsMTggQEAKKzIwMTEtMDUtMDQgIEFsZXhpcyBN
ZW5hcmQgIDxhbGV4aXMubWVuYXJkQG9wZW5ib3NzYS5vcmc+CisKKyAgICAgICAgUmV2aWV3ZWQg
YnkgTk9CT0RZIChPT1BTISkuCisKKyAgICAgICAgW1F0XSBSZW5kZXJUaGVtZVF0IGFuZCBEdW1w
UmVuZGVyVHJlZVN1cHBvcnRRdCBzaG91bGQgdXNlIG51bGxwdHIgcmF0aGVyIHRoYW4gMC4KKyAg
ICAgICAgaHR0cHM6Ly9idWdzLndlYmtpdC5vcmcvc2hvd19idWcuY2dpP2lkPTYwMjI0CisKKyAg
ICAgICAgV2Ugc2hvdWxkIHVzZSBudWxscHRyIHJhdGhlciB0aGFuIDAuIG51bGxwdHIgd2lsbCBi
ZSBhZGRlZCBpbiB0aGUgbmV3IEMrKyBzdGFuZGFyZAorICAgICAgICBidXQgd2Via2l0IGFscmVh
ZHkgaGF2ZSBhIG51bGxwdHIgY2xhc3MgaWYgdGhlcmUgaXMgbm8gYysrMHggc3VwcG9ydC4KKwor
ICAgICAgICAqIHBsYXRmb3JtL3F0L1JlbmRlclRoZW1lUXQuY3BwOgorICAgICAgICAoV2ViQ29y
ZTo6UmVuZGVyVGhlbWVRdDo6YWRqdXN0UHJvZ3Jlc3NCYXJTdHlsZSk6CisgICAgICAgIChXZWJD
b3JlOjpSZW5kZXJUaGVtZVF0OjphZGp1c3RTbGlkZXJUcmFja1N0eWxlKToKKyAgICAgICAgKFdl
YkNvcmU6OlJlbmRlclRoZW1lUXQ6OmFkanVzdFNsaWRlclRodW1iU3R5bGUpOgorCiAyMDExLTA1
LTA0ICBGcmlkcmljaCBTdHJiYSAgPGZyaWRyaWNoLnN0cmJhQGJsdWV3aW4uY2g+CiAKICAgICAg
ICAgUmV2aWV3ZWQgYnkgQWRhbSBCYXJ0aC4KSW5kZXg6IFNvdXJjZS9XZWJDb3JlL3BsYXRmb3Jt
L3F0L1JlbmRlclRoZW1lUXQuY3BwCj09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T0KLS0tIFNvdXJjZS9XZWJDb3JlL3BsYXRm
b3JtL3F0L1JlbmRlclRoZW1lUXQuY3BwCShyZXZpc2lvbiA4NTc5NykKKysrIFNvdXJjZS9XZWJD
b3JlL3BsYXRmb3JtL3F0L1JlbmRlclRoZW1lUXQuY3BwCSh3b3JraW5nIGNvcHkpCkBAIC04NTMs
NyArODUzLDcgQEAgZG91YmxlIFJlbmRlclRoZW1lUXQ6OmFuaW1hdGlvbkR1cmF0aW9uRgogCiB2
b2lkIFJlbmRlclRoZW1lUXQ6OmFkanVzdFByb2dyZXNzQmFyU3R5bGUoQ1NTU3R5bGVTZWxlY3Rv
ciosIFJlbmRlclN0eWxlKiBzdHlsZSwgRWxlbWVudCopIGNvbnN0CiB7Ci0gICAgc3R5bGUtPnNl
dEJveFNoYWRvdygwKTsKKyAgICBzdHlsZS0+c2V0Qm94U2hhZG93KG51bGxwdHIpOwogfQogCiBi
b29sIFJlbmRlclRoZW1lUXQ6OnBhaW50UHJvZ3Jlc3NCYXIoUmVuZGVyT2JqZWN0KiBvLCBjb25z
dCBQYWludEluZm8mIHBpLCBjb25zdCBJbnRSZWN0JiByKQpAQCAtOTUwLDcgKzk1MCw3IEBAIGJv
b2wgUmVuZGVyVGhlbWVRdDo6cGFpbnRTbGlkZXJUcmFjayhSZW4KIAogdm9pZCBSZW5kZXJUaGVt
ZVF0OjphZGp1c3RTbGlkZXJUcmFja1N0eWxlKENTU1N0eWxlU2VsZWN0b3IqLCBSZW5kZXJTdHls
ZSogc3R5bGUsIEVsZW1lbnQqKSBjb25zdAogewotICAgIHN0eWxlLT5zZXRCb3hTaGFkb3coMCk7
CisgICAgc3R5bGUtPnNldEJveFNoYWRvdyhudWxscHRyKTsKIH0KIAogYm9vbCBSZW5kZXJUaGVt
ZVF0OjpwYWludFNsaWRlclRodW1iKFJlbmRlck9iamVjdCogbywgY29uc3QgUGFpbnRJbmZvJiBw
aSwKQEAgLTk2Miw3ICs5NjIsNyBAQCBib29sIFJlbmRlclRoZW1lUXQ6OnBhaW50U2xpZGVyVGh1
bWIoUmVuCiAKIHZvaWQgUmVuZGVyVGhlbWVRdDo6YWRqdXN0U2xpZGVyVGh1bWJTdHlsZShDU1NT
dHlsZVNlbGVjdG9yKiwgUmVuZGVyU3R5bGUqIHN0eWxlLCBFbGVtZW50KikgY29uc3QKIHsKLSAg
ICBzdHlsZS0+c2V0Qm94U2hhZG93KDApOworICAgIHN0eWxlLT5zZXRCb3hTaGFkb3cobnVsbHB0
cik7CiB9CiAKIGJvb2wgUmVuZGVyVGhlbWVRdDo6cGFpbnRTZWFyY2hGaWVsZChSZW5kZXJPYmpl
Y3QqIG8sIGNvbnN0IFBhaW50SW5mbyYgcGksCkluZGV4OiBTb3VyY2UvV2ViS2l0L3F0L0NoYW5n
ZUxvZwo9P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09Ci0tLSBTb3VyY2UvV2ViS2l0L3F0L0NoYW5nZUxvZwkocmV2aXNpb24g
ODU4MDApCisrKyBTb3VyY2UvV2ViS2l0L3F0L0NoYW5nZUxvZwkod29ya2luZyBjb3B5KQpAQCAt
MSwzICsxLDE2IEBACisyMDExLTA1LTA0ICBBbGV4aXMgTWVuYXJkICA8YWxleGlzLm1lbmFyZEBv
cGVuYm9zc2Eub3JnPgorCisgICAgICAgIFJldmlld2VkIGJ5IE5PQk9EWSAoT09QUyEpLgorCisg
ICAgICAgIFtRdF0gUmVuZGVyVGhlbWVRdCBhbmQgRHVtcFJlbmRlclRyZWVTdXBwb3J0UXQgc2hv
dWxkIHVzZSBudWxscHRyIHJhdGhlciB0aGFuIDAuCisgICAgICAgIGh0dHBzOi8vYnVncy53ZWJr
aXQub3JnL3Nob3dfYnVnLmNnaT9pZD02MDIyNAorCisgICAgICAgIFdlIHNob3VsZCB1c2UgbnVs
bHB0ciByYXRoZXIgdGhhbiAwLiBudWxscHRyIHdpbGwgYmUgYWRkZWQgaW4gdGhlIG5ldyBDKysg
c3RhbmRhcmQKKyAgICAgICAgYnV0IHdlYmtpdCBhbHJlYWR5IGhhdmUgYSBudWxscHRyIGNsYXNz
IGlmIHRoZXJlIGlzIG5vIGMrKzB4IHN1cHBvcnQuCisKKyAgICAgICAgKiBXZWJDb3JlU3VwcG9y
dC9EdW1wUmVuZGVyVHJlZVN1cHBvcnRRdC5jcHA6CisgICAgICAgIChEdW1wUmVuZGVyVHJlZVN1
cHBvcnRRdDo6YWRkVXNlclN0eWxlU2hlZXQpOgorCiAyMDExLTA1LTA0ICBBbGV4aXMgTWVuYXJk
ICA8YWxleGlzLm1lbmFyZEBvcGVuYm9zc2Eub3JnPgogCiAgICAgICAgIFVucmV2aWV3ZWQgd2Fy
bmluZyBmaXguCkluZGV4OiBTb3VyY2UvV2ViS2l0L3F0L1dlYkNvcmVTdXBwb3J0L0R1bXBSZW5k
ZXJUcmVlU3VwcG9ydFF0LmNwcAo9P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09
P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09Ci0tLSBTb3VyY2UvV2ViS2l0L3F0L1dlYkNv
cmVTdXBwb3J0L0R1bXBSZW5kZXJUcmVlU3VwcG9ydFF0LmNwcAkocmV2aXNpb24gODU3OTcpCisr
KyBTb3VyY2UvV2ViS2l0L3F0L1dlYkNvcmVTdXBwb3J0L0R1bXBSZW5kZXJUcmVlU3VwcG9ydFF0
LmNwcAkod29ya2luZyBjb3B5KQpAQCAtOTM3LDcgKzkzNyw3IEBAIFFTdHJpbmcgRHVtcFJlbmRl
clRyZWVTdXBwb3J0UXQ6OnBhZ2VQcm8KIAogdm9pZCBEdW1wUmVuZGVyVHJlZVN1cHBvcnRRdDo6
YWRkVXNlclN0eWxlU2hlZXQoUVdlYlBhZ2UqIHBhZ2UsIGNvbnN0IFFTdHJpbmcmIHNvdXJjZUNv
ZGUpCiB7Ci0gICAgcGFnZS0+aGFuZGxlKCktPnBhZ2UtPmdyb3VwKCkuYWRkVXNlclN0eWxlU2hl
ZXRUb1dvcmxkKG1haW5UaHJlYWROb3JtYWxXb3JsZCgpLCBzb3VyY2VDb2RlLCBRVXJsKCksIDAs
IDAsIFdlYkNvcmU6OkluamVjdEluQWxsRnJhbWVzKTsKKyAgICBwYWdlLT5oYW5kbGUoKS0+cGFn
ZS0+Z3JvdXAoKS5hZGRVc2VyU3R5bGVTaGVldFRvV29ybGQobWFpblRocmVhZE5vcm1hbFdvcmxk
KCksIHNvdXJjZUNvZGUsIFFVcmwoKSwgbnVsbHB0ciwgbnVsbHB0ciwgV2ViQ29yZTo6SW5qZWN0
SW5BbGxGcmFtZXMpOwogfQogCiB2b2lkIER1bXBSZW5kZXJUcmVlU3VwcG9ydFF0OjpzaW11bGF0
ZURlc2t0b3BOb3RpZmljYXRpb25DbGljayhjb25zdCBRU3RyaW5nJiB0aXRsZSkK
</data>
<flag name="review"
          id="85294"
          type_id="1"
          status="+"
          setter="kling"
    />
    <flag name="commit-queue"
          id="85295"
          type_id="3"
          status="-"
          setter="kling"
    />
          </attachment>
      

    </bug>

</bugzilla>